[Xapian-tickets] [Xapian] #449: Bad code on Ubuntu Hardy GCC 4.2, -O2
Xapian
nobody at xapian.org
Tue Feb 23 13:23:04 GMT 2010
#449: Bad code on Ubuntu Hardy GCC 4.2, -O2
---------------------------+------------------------------------------------
Reporter: olly | Owner: olly
Type: defect | Status: assigned
Priority: normal | Milestone: 1.0.19
Component: Backend-Chert | Version: 1.1.4
Severity: normal | Keywords:
Blockedby: | Platform: All
Blocking: |
---------------------------+------------------------------------------------
Changes (by olly):
* milestone: 1.1.5 => 1.0.19
Comment:
I've committed the patch to trunk (with an expanded comment pointing to
the GCC bug and this ticket to help out future developers) as r14068.
Since packages of 1.0.18 built successfully on Ubuntu hardy, it seems this
bug doesn't affect 1.0 branch, though I wonder if it would be prudent to
backport this to avoid any potential problems. My initial thinking was
that the bug must be in new code in chert (perhaps pack.h) but the log
shows it failing topercent2 with the inmemory backend. The only downside
seems to be a likely performance degradation in the generated code.
So setting the milestone to 1.0.19 for now.
--
Ticket URL: <http://trac.xapian.org/ticket/449#comment:8>
Xapian <http://xapian.org/>
Xapian
More information about the Xapian-tickets
mailing list